In “Paradise,” San Antonio printmaker Kim Bishop’s lushly robust 2 ’ x 4’ prints hang alongside the woodcut boards themselves, which through paint and ink are transformed into their own boldly mesmerizing, almost sculptural graphic drawings. The show will open with an artist’s talk and reception from 2PM to 5PM on Saturday January 18 and close on Sunday February 9. With “Paradise,” the Ney continues its participation in PrintAustin, the annual month-long celebration of print arts. See www.printaustin.org for more information.
